Output 58a330317fcd2cf6410a91f640c2f46bedf38e5e2de02a639e3a013a5f7c3601:0

value
17366489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2795a0f4c323afd416d07fb48207adb9a0d422cd OP_EQUALVERIFY OP_CHECKSIG
address
14cJbsMRS3EeS8VMMNJuVnDNpjwVs3kvBZ
transaction
58a330317fcd2cf6410a91f640c2f46bedf38e5e2de02a639e3a013a5f7c3601
spent
true